当前位置: 首页 > news >正文

郑州网站建设网页设计花蝴蝶免费视频在线观看高清版

郑州网站建设网页设计,花蝴蝶免费视频在线观看高清版,wordpress手机不显示图片,彩灯制作公司 题目 给你一个字符串 s 、一个字符串 t 。返回 s 中涵盖 t 所有字符的最小子串。如果 s 中不存在涵盖 t 所有字符的子串,则返回空字符串 “” 。 注意: 对于 t 中重复字符,我们寻找的子字符串中该字符数量必须不少于 t 中该字符数量。 如果 s 中存在这样的子串,我们保…

 题目
给你一个字符串 s 、一个字符串 t 。返回 s 中涵盖 t 所有字符的最小子串。如果 s 中不存在涵盖 t 所有字符的子串,则返回空字符串 “” 。

注意:

对于 t 中重复字符,我们寻找的子字符串中该字符数量必须不少于 t 中该字符数量。
如果 s 中存在这样的子串,我们保证它是唯一的答案。

示例 1:

输入:s = “ADOBECODEBANC”, t = “ABC”
输出:“BANC”
解释:最小覆盖子串 “BANC” 包含来自字符串 t 的 ‘A’、‘B’ 和 ‘C’。

示例 2:

输入:s = “a”, t = “a”
输出:“a”
解释:整个字符串 s 是最小覆盖子串。

示例 3:

输入: s = “a”, t = “aa”
输出: “”
解释: t 中两个字符 ‘a’ 均应包含在 s 的子串中,
因此没有符合条件的子字符串,返回空字符串。

提示:

m == s.length
n == t.length
1 <= m, n <= 105
s 和 t 由英文字母组成

进阶:你能设计一个在 o(m+n) 时间内解决此问题的算法吗?

 java代码
这个问题可以使用滑动窗口算法来解决。滑动窗口算法通常用于找到包含一组特定字符或元素的最短子串。

以下是使用Java实现的滑动窗口算法来找到涵盖字符串 t 所有字符的最小子串:

http://www.yayakq.cn/news/842202/

相关文章:

  • ps怎么做网站一寸的照片珠海北京网站建设
  • 网站做访问追踪校园网络工程设计方案
  • 网站内容避免被采集长沙网站优化排名推广
  • 高埗网站仿做关于企业的网站
  • 怎么查网站备案域名备案智库门户网站建设
  • 学怎么做建筑标书哪个网站网站开发与设计静态网页源代码
  • 网站建设代码合同网站建设维护员
  • 如何快速学会做网站wordpress手机上图片不显示
  • 做网站界面尺寸是多少合肥百姓网网站建设
  • 定制礼品的网站有哪些室内装修设计学习网
  • 东莞seo网站优化方式算命网站该怎样做
  • 怎么创办自己的网站海口网站设计公司
  • 佛山网站制作在线做网站 计算机有交嘛
  • 网站想换空间设计师个人网站模板
  • 苍南建设网站黄骅港务集团有限公司官网
  • 博物馆网站开发做网站乱码
  • 用v9做的网站上传服务器最流行的网络营销方式
  • 毕业设计可以做哪些简单网站央企网站群建设中标公告
  • 新网 网站备案杭州网站建设图片
  • 海南省建设集团有限公司网站seo整站优化服务
  • 重庆网站建设大概需要多少钱企业网站带手机源码
  • 淘客网站推广免备案长沙官网网站制作公司
  • 如何查询网站接入商十堰网络公司排行榜
  • 北京通州网站制作公司带动画的网站模板
  • 网站建设流北京模板网站开发全包
  • 淄博网站建设 招聘微信朋友圈推广
  • 福建省建设系统网站国际电商怎么做
  • 网站改版 升级的目的是什么广告创意与设计
  • 网站建设方面的书籍推荐建设外包网站
  • 国家示范校建设成果网站常熟做网站公司